The obstacles are numerous. Even Jupiter's magnetic field is a huge problem. There was recent talk that this missions electronics may not be sufficiently hardened. Typically, space probes to the gas giants will have a highly elliptical orbit to mitigate potential radiation damage.
So just surviving in Europa's orbit is a problem. Landing on Europa is another huge problem. There's no atmosphere to brake into. An icy surface may have crevasses and such and you could potentially immediately lose your probe. So how do you land safely on ice when you don't know how much weight that surface will support? A solution might be to do a burn to slow down and do a stationary land but that's also complex and adds a lot of weight. Also the engines and the fuel need to survive for 7 years until they're used.
Conquer all those obstacles and you're now on the surface. Now what? The ocea is under kilometers of ice so you can't really reach it. You really have to look for a volcano/geyser and you have to get to what that produces without being destroyed or damaged. Does the ice thin? Is there heat that means the ice thins and there's (heated) liquid water underneath? We really have no idea.
Finally you get a sample of subsurface ocean water and now what? What does life look like? How do you detect that? What signatures are you looking for? How do you avoid contamination from EArth-based life? That's not as easy as you might think.
The contingencies and redundancies required are jus tmind-bogglingly complex.
